IContract.QueryContract Method
Returns a contract that is implemented by this contract.
Namespace: System.AddIn.Contract
Assembly: System.AddIn.Contract (in System.AddIn.Contract.dll)
Parameters
- contractIdentifier
- Type: System.String
A string that identifies the contract that is being requested.
Return Value
Type: System.AddIn.Contract.IContractAn IContract that represents a contract that a client is requesting from the current contract; null if the current contract does not support the contract that is requested.
The QueryContract method enables IContract objects to expose other contracts. QueryContract serves a purpose similar to that of the IUnknown.QueryInterface method in COM.
The format of the strings used to identify contracts is defined by the IContract implementation. It is recommended that you use the AssemblyQualifiedName of the contract that is being queried.
